Quarter of a Century with the Traveling Public and What it Taught Me, by Edwin Kachel. Price one dollar.

[Seattle: Progressive Printing Co.], 1937.

Octavo (20 x14.5 cm.), [10], 113 pages. Illustrated with a portrait of the author. FIRST & ONLY EDITION. A memoir of a railroad steward, having served in dining-car service on the Portland to Seattle run since 1911. In part a guide to ‘Humanized Hospitality’ on the railroads, and in part profiles of some of the celebrities the author served. Green-titled wrappers, backed in brown cloth; small stain to front panel, otherwise near fine. Inscribed at length in green ink by the author on the free front endpaper, and dated 1953. [OCLC locates nine copies].
